Price Comparison
The pooboo Under Desk Bike Pedal Exerciser is priced at $199.99, making it about 44% cheaper than the VANSWE Recumbent Exercise Bike, which retails for $358.97. This significant price difference can heavily influence buyers, especially those on a budget or looking for a simple, effective workout solution. While the pooboo bike offers a compact and portable design ideal for home office therapy, the VANSWE bike comes with features that cater to a more comprehensive workout experience, justifying its higher price point. Overall, if budget is a primary concern, the pooboo under desk bike presents a more economical option.
Design and Portability
The pooboo Under Desk Bike Pedal Exerciser shines in terms of design and portability. Weighing only 18.9 lbs and featuring a built-in handle, it is easy to carry and store, making it perfect for those with limited space. In contrast, the VANSWE Recumbent Exercise Bike, while robust and stable, is designed for more permanent placement due to its weight and size. The recumbent design offers comfort but lacks the portability necessary for users seeking flexibility. Therefore, if you need a workout solution that fits seamlessly into a busy lifestyle or a small living space, the pooboo bike is the superior choice.
Workout Options
When it comes to workout versatility, the VANSWE Recumbent Exercise Bike offers a more comprehensive experience. It features moveable arm handles and elliptical-sized foot pedals, allowing users to engage both upper and lower body muscles simultaneously. This full-body workout capability is a significant advantage for those seeking efficiency in their exercise routines. Meanwhile, the pooboo Under Desk Bike caters to both arm and leg workouts with its forward and reverse pedaling options, but it remains primarily focused on low-impact exercise. For users looking to maximize their workout efficiency, the VANSWE bike provides more robust options.
Comfort and Ergonomics
Comfort is a critical factor in any exercise bike, and the VANSWE Recumbent Exercise Bike excels in this area. Its recumbent design features an ergonomically padded seat and backrest, which reduces strain on the back, knees, and ankles. This makes it particularly suitable for seniors or anyone recovering from injury. On the other hand, the pooboo Under Desk Bike, while compact and functional, does not prioritize comfort to the same extent. Its design is more straightforward, focusing on utility rather than prolonged use comfort. For users prioritizing a comfortable workout session, the VANSWE bike is the better option.
Noise Level
The pooboo Under Desk Bike Pedal Exerciser operates with a quiet magnetic resistance system, producing noise levels below 15dB. This feature allows users to exercise without disturbing others, making it ideal for home office settings or shared living spaces. Conversely, while the VANSWE Recumbent Exercise Bike also promises a smooth and quiet workout, it is not specified how its noise levels compare. For those who value a quiet workout experience, especially in environments where noise might be an issue, the pooboo bike clearly stands out.
Technology and Tracking
In terms of technological features, the VANSWE Recumbent Exercise Bike includes Bluetooth connectivity and is compatible with popular fitness apps like Kinomap and Zwift. This connectivity allows users to track their workouts in real-time, enhancing the overall exercise experience. On the other hand, the pooboo Under Desk Bike comes equipped with an LCD monitor to track time, speed, distance, calories, and ODO, but lacks advanced connectivity features. For tech-savvy users seeking to integrate their workouts with modern fitness tracking apps, the VANSWE bike is the clear winner.
User Experience and Accessibility
The user experience varies significantly between these two bikes. The VANSWE Recumbent Exercise Bike is designed for users ranging from 5'2" to 6'5", thanks to its adjustable seat slider. This adaptability makes it suitable for a wide range of users, including families with varying heights. In contrast, the pooboo Under Desk Bike, while easy to use, may not offer the same level of accessibility for taller individuals. For multi-user households or those with family members of different sizes, the VANSWE bike is a more inclusive option.
